A very special suitcase from Louis Vuitton was spotted at the Louis Vuitton fashion show. It is, in fact, the hand-held suitcase that Jaden Smith was seen with. He was on his way to the Louis Vuitton show and was carrying a very unique suitcase with his outfit. The bag is special because it is supposed to represent the Arc de Triomphe in Paris.
Arc de Triomphe
The suitcase is made entirely of the iconic monogram canvas print and is full of details. The suitcase is based on one of the most famous landmarks in Paris, namely the Arc de Triomphe. Accordingly, the suitcase is shaped like the Arc de Triomphe and is designed like an arch. It is finished with gold details, which can be seen on the sides, where you can open the case. You open it with a click system that is also found on several Louis Vuitton bags. The suitcase has one handle, which - as with most Louis Vuitton suitcases and bags - is made of Vachetta leather.

Interior
Another nice detail of the suitcase is that, unlike a standard suitcase, you don't have a lot of open space when you open it. This suitcase is divided into seven different compartments, so you can store different Louis Vuitton items in each compartment. For example, the middle and also largest compartment is specially designed to hold Louis Vuitton perfume, and the compartments on the side are for earrings. There are also two more drawers at the top, where you can store your Louis Vuitton bracelets. In short, a unique bag and definitely a collector's item.

Collectors piece
The miniature replica of the iconic Arch of Triumph is more than a fashion accessory—it's a collector's piece. As part of a Louis Vuitton series that reimagines renowned landmarks as wearable art, this exceptional bag stands out for its meticulous craftsmanship and exclusivity, making it a true head-turner. But what does this particular suitcase actually cost? Well, the suitcase can only be made to by pre-order. You will pay €36,000 for it. But yes, then you also have an unique Louis Vuitton item!
